Did you know that solar panels work just as well in the UK as they do anywhere else in the world, regardless of the weather? You don't need to live in a place that's sunny all year round to generate solar energy. Even on cloudy days, solar panels can still generate energy. However, it's worth noting that the more sunshine you get, the more energy you'll produce.

When planning for solar panel installation, the available roof space is a critical factor to consider. In most residential settings, roofs are not uniform, and the presence of chimneys, vents, and other obstructions can limit the available area for panel placement. It's essential to conduct a detailed roof assessment to evaluate how many panels can fit and their arrangement.

A 375-watt solar panel is designed to convert sunlight into electrical energy, boasting a maximum output of 375 watts under optimal conditions. These conditions typically refer to a sunny day with the sun directly overhead, known as Standard Test Conditions (STC). The primary components of solar panels include photovoltaic (PV) cells, which are responsible for the conversion of sunlight to electricity. The efficiency of a panel often hinges on the quality of these cells and the overall design of the panel.

4. Ease of Installation Many solar kits are designed for straightforward installation, often requiring minimal tools and technical skills. Some kits come with detailed instructions or video tutorials to guide users through the setup process. For those who may feel unsure about installation, professional installation services are often available through the retailer or manufacturer.
